With the Oscars coming up quickly, we spoke with the woman behind the design landscape for Sinners: Hannah Beachler. She’s been director Ryan Coogler’s go-to production designer for several films, including Fruitvale Station, Creed, two Black Panther movies, and now Sinners, which smashed the record for most Academy Award nominations. Beachler sat down for a long, ranging interview full of Sinners lore and what challenge she wants to take on next.  But first, we hit the news: Crotchgate, everything else in Olympics design, Jony Ive’s Ferrari, the enshittification of ChatGPT, and the trial of Meta and Google’s allegedly addictive design.  We’ll close with a new segment: Fix Your Shit. This episode’s target: Microsoft Teams.
